Transaction cd580e737030638bace3be84a58f5676b1b4ea15860fdfe7b0a84764ee6ebff9
1 Input
2 Outputs
- cd580e737030638bace3be84a58f5676b1b4ea15860fdfe7b0a84764ee6ebff9:0
- cd580e737030638bace3be84a58f5676b1b4ea15860fdfe7b0a84764ee6ebff9:1
value 79703
address 1KvNLmNeR7ajquVmF3HNfrgswGWmxCxTmB
value 209921
address 38VB4bpc11EDcvijkDLQZwR2gKxvnLTv4u